Coordinator Technical Support
Reports to: Operations Manager Last Update : 9/14/2021
Overview: Ensures projects are delivered on schedule and at budget by performing basic project management function; researching basic business and technical issues. Works with no supervision.
Essential Duties : (Approximate % of Time Spent)
- Ensures attainment of project schedules. (~30%)
- Document and handle project scope changes, communicate revised project schedule and issues change orders for customer approval. (~20%)
- Researches business and technical issues to establish what is being done and where improvements are possible. (~10%)
- Contributes to team efforts by accomplishing related results in a cooperative and supportive manner. (~10%)
- Attends and participates in project closure meetings and financial meetings. (~10%)
- Development & management of the field labor model and the quarterly reviews. (~10%)
- Conduct internal and customer kick off meetings, participates on cross-functional teams, internal and external inter-departmental issues; establishing and communicating project schedules, objectives, priorities, and targets. (~10%)
Non-Essential Duties : Performs other duties as assigned.

Minimum Education and Certification:
- Bachelor's degree from a four-year college or university, preferably in Engineering or related field.
- Two years related experience and/or training.
Minimum Experience:
- Experience with ERP systems.
- Working with multi-discipline teams.
- Experience with project scheduling.
- Experience in customer service oriented roles.
Leadership:
- No leadership responsibilities, but may serve as a resource to others with less experience.
Physical Demands: (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.)
- Standard requirements. Bending, squatting, climbing, stooping, twisting and reaching will all be required occasionally in this position.
- Sitting for long periods of time.
- Lifting 10 pounds' maximum with occasional lifting and/or carrying of objects weighing up to 10 pounds.
- Must meet all OSHA regulations and must wear all required PPE when in the field/shop environment.

STRONG, DEPENDABLE SERVICE - OUR CUSTOMERS COUNT ON ARCHROCK Archrock, Inc., (NYSE:AROC) is the leading provider of natural gas contract compression services to customers in the oil and natural gas industry throughout the United States. For more than 60 years, customers have relied on the unmatched expertise of our highly qualified, certified technicians. This legacy makes us the U.S. compression services leader. We offer our customers services using the countrys largest fleet, well-established relationships with OEM manufacturers and distributors, and an unmatched aftermarket parts and servic...e capability. We bridge the gap for our customers from challenge to solution across the United States With more operating horsepower than anyone else, we are strategically located where our clients need us.
